Abstract

The application discloses an energy-saving environment-friendly LED street lamp, which comprises a lamp post, an LED lighting unit, a fixing flange, a mounting plate and a bearing plate, wherein a rectangular through hole and a circular through hole are formed in the mounting plate, a storage battery borne at the bearing plate is installed at the rectangular through hole, a circle of first positioning hole is also formed in the mounting plate, a cylindrical first stand column is inserted in the circular through hole, a second stand column is fixed at the top end of the first stand column, a solar panel is fixed at the top end of the second stand column, a circular limiting ring is also fixed at the first stand column, a second positioning hole is formed in the limiting ring, the first positioning hole is a threaded hole, the second positioning hole is a through hole, and one first positioning hole in each second positioning hole and the circle of first positioning holes is fixedly connected through a positioning bolt; and a reinforced connecting plate is also connected between the bearing plate and the bottom end of the first upright post. The street lamp is energy-saving and environment-friendly, and has strong adaptability to the installation of lamp poles with different shapes.

Detailed Description
Reference numerals: 1, fixing a flange; 1.1 a flange through hole; 1.2 second reinforcing ribs; 2, mounting a plate; 2.1 rectangular through holes; 2.2 connecting rods; 2.3 carrying plate; 2.4 circular through holes; 2.5 a first locating hole; 3, reinforcing the connecting plate; 4, a storage battery; 5.1 a first upright; 5.2 a second upright; 5.3 solar panels; 5.4 limiting ring.
As shown in the figure: an energy-saving environment-friendly LED street lamp comprises a lamp post, an LED lighting unit arranged at the lamp post, a fixed flange 1 fixedly connected with the lamp post, a mounting plate 2 fixedly connected with the fixed flange 1, and a bearing plate 2.3 fixedly connected with the mounting plate 2 through a plurality of connecting rods 2.2, wherein the mounting plate 2 is provided with a rectangular through hole 2.1 and a circular through hole 2.4, the rectangular through hole 2.1 is provided with a storage battery 4 borne at the bearing plate 2.3, the mounting plate 2 is also provided with a circle of first positioning holes 2.5 surrounding the circular through hole, a cylindrical first upright post 5.1 is inserted into the circular through hole 2.4, the top end of the first upright post 5.1 is fixedly provided with a second upright post 5.2, the top end of the second upright post 5.2 is fixedly provided with a solar panel 5.3, the first upright post 5.1 is also fixedly provided with a circular limiting ring 5.4, the second positioning hole is arranged at the position of the limiting ring 5.4, and the first positioning hole 2.5 is a threaded hole, the second positioning holes are through holes, and each second positioning hole is fixedly connected with one first positioning hole 2.5 of the circle of first positioning holes through a positioning bolt; and a reinforced connecting plate 3 is also connected between the bottom ends of the bearing plate 2.3 and the first upright post 5.1.
The storage battery 4 is a lithium battery. The connecting rod 2.2 has 4, the connecting rod 2.2 is the montant, the loading board 2.3 is the rectangular plate, the height of battery 4 is greater than the height of connecting rod 2.2. The section of the second upright post 5.2 is rectangular, and a first reinforcing rib is connected between the first upright post 5.1 and the second upright post 5.2; the top end of the second upright post 5.2 is provided with an end flange fixedly connected with the back surface of the solar panel 5.3. The number of the first limiting holes 2.5 is more than or equal to 18, and the number of the second limiting holes is between 2 and 4. The utility model discloses a vertical column, including reinforcing connecting plate 3, reinforcing connecting plate 3 includes the rectangular plate and with rectangular plate integrated into one piece's semicircle board, reinforcing connecting plate 3 is through first bolt and first stand 5.1's bottom fixed connection, reinforcing connecting plate 3 is through second bolt and loading board 2.3 fixed connection, first stand 5.1's low side have the round be annular equidistant distribution with first bolt complex screw thread blind hole, first bolt has two. A plurality of second reinforcing ribs 1.2 are arranged between the fixed flange 1 and the mounting plate 2; the fixing flange 1 and the mounting plate 2 are connected in a T-shaped structure.
